Biography

Bernie Casey was an American actor and former professional American football player. Born Bernard Terry Casey on 8 June 1939 in Wyco, West Virginia, he was a wide receiver in the NFL for the San Francisco 49ers and Los Angeles Rams after starring in football and track at Bowling Green State University. He made his film debut in Guns of the Magnificent Seven (1969) and appeared as Peters in The Man Who Fell to Earth (1976).

Casey became prominent in 1970s blaxploitation films and later took supporting roles in Never Say Never Again (1983), Revenge of the Nerds (1984), Spies Like Us (1985), Bill & Ted's Excellent Adventure (1989) and Under Siege (1992). He also appeared in television series including Star Trek: Deep Space Nine and Babylon 5. He won an NAACP Image Award for his performance in Maurie (1973). Casey died on 19 September 2017 in Los Angeles.
